A hard rock supergroup formed in 1972 by Leslie West, Jack Bruce and Corky Laing; produced in the group's orbit by Felix Pappalardi. They released two studio albums and live recordings before disbanding.

Formed from members associated with Mountain (Leslie West, Corky Laing) and former Cream bassist Jack Bruce; produced/connected with Felix Pappalardi; debut album Why Dontcha was their best-selling release but received mixed critical reception.

West, Bruce & Laing were a short-lived hard rock supergroup formed from members of Mountain and Cream's circle. Their debut Why Dontcha sold best but is judged uneven compared with contemporaries. The project lasted only a couple of albums and some live recordings.
